It seems as though all things the new Duchess of Cambridge, Kate Middleton touches turns to style gold. Everything from her avant garde headwear, to her now famous navy blue dress, have all become new fashion staples. Let’s also not forget style watch 2011, with the world waiting to see what her wedding dress would look like, thus sparking the summer lace trend. She is surely to become a fashion icon on par with Jackie O and Princess Diana, all while fashionistas the globe over wait to see what the princess will wear next. Her style can be best described as being effortlessly classic. Kate always looks comfortable and confident in all of her ensembles, both key ingredients in having amazing style.

That being said, there is one accessory I am just not sure about that Ms. Middleton has begun to sport recently; sheer pantyhose. Rarely seen since the 80’s, these sheer stockings seem to be making a comeback, appearing on Kate a number of times during her Royal tour. Shocking, since no one has really thought about hose since Melanie Griffith wore them in virtually every scene of “Working Girl”. So is the sudden interest in hose a royal requirement, or actually a deliberate fashion statement?

Like anything else, there are pros and cons to wearing such a throw back piece.

Pros:

*Sheer nylons will hide any discoloration, spider veins, etc, on your legs.

*The shimmer quality is actually kind of eye catching

*You legs do end up looking flawless

Cons:

*Runs in your stockings!

*Looking like you are a slave to fashion that was decades ago

*People stopping to ask you, “are you seriously wearing pantyhose?”

Being that Kate is such a trend setter, one has to pause a moment and wonder, are sheer stockings really about to make a come back? It has been reported by the fashion website, www.tightsplease.com that they have seen a ninety percent increase in nude tight sales than that of the previous year. Wow! Leave it to Kate Middleton to revive a dead trend!

It is no secret that the ‘Harry Potter’ movies have made wildly successful movie stars out of it’s three main characters, but what the franchise likely did not anticipate was making a fashion icon out of one Emma Watson. A true style chameleon, Emma’s fashion choices are ever changing, and always decidedly different. Her wardrobe choices can range from ultra feminine frocks to rocker sheik ensembles. With fashion campaigns at Burberry to her own collaboration with Alberta Ferretti on the eco-friendly line ‘Pure Threads’, Emma has more than proven herself worthy to be called a true blue fashionista. Not only are her style choices usually impeccable, she always seems as though she puts a lot of thought into each outfit, making it stand out on nearly every red carpet she is seen on; and the latest and final installment of the billion dollar movie franchise was certainly no exception.

At the New York world premiere of ‘Potter’, Watson took what would be considered by most to be a fashion risk wearing a very avant garde gown. The Bottega Venetta creation boasted a grey tone corset top and an incredibly structured yellow gold bottom, making it undeniably eye catching. Her sleek styled pixie cut completed the look, as well as some gorgeous eye make up.

Her gown for the London premiere would also stand to make most girls extremely jealous! Looking every bit a real life princess, Watson’s ethereal Oscar De La Renta dress looked absolutely stunning. The jewel encrusted strapless cream bodice and layers of lilac tulle were definitely hard to miss, amplified only by her clever decision to go minimal on her accessories, letting the dress speak for itself.

Perhaps my favorite of all her premiere looks, was her distinctive spin on the little black dress. The beautiful dress featured a peek a boo lace look, complete with a black feathered tutu-esque bottom and sky high stilettos. The fun and flirty aspect of the dress made it unforgettable, and proved that this girl can really wear just about anything.

One thing that never fails to stand out about the actress is her expertly applied make up. Emma usually does the ‘I’m not wearing any make up face’ with one stand out feature; lips, eyes what have you. The great part about her look is it can be easily replicated.

For a fresh face, a tinted moisterizer or powder works wonders, as heavy foundation will negate the less is more look. A liquid highlighter can be used instead of regular blush on your cheek bones, leaving your skin with that lovely early morning dewy feel. Now comes time to pick the feature you want to accentuate; whatever that may be, stick to neutrals on the other areas. Emma is fond of highlighting her eyes, using smoky shadows and liner. For this, a soft or nude lip looks best, while a white eye liner pencil should be used on your bottom lids so we don’t take it too dark.

Emma also has an apparent affinity for darker nail colors; shades like OPI’s ‘My Private Jet’ or ‘Russian Navy’ would suit her (or your) dark side perfectly!

Whenever summer rolls around, we usually get so excited to bring out the brights that have been taking up residence in the back of our closet, that we forget there is a whole different color palette of options out there. Being in the Bay Area, we all know firsthand that sometimes summer isn’t very summery here. Case in point, as I sit and type, it is pretty dreary and misty outside..in July! So, rather than revert back to our fall wardrobe so early in the summer season, I implore you ladies to try out the neutral and pastel color wheel that can be easily overlooked this time of year. I know, I know, I say pastel and we immediately think of looking like an Easter egg, but that does not always have to be the case, promise! Lilacs, greys, mint greens and off whites would all be lovely additions to your wardrobe, as well as extremely easy to throw on when the weather is less than stellar.

A great way to exude a fashionable front here is to pair your soft colors together, colorblocking is not only for brights after all! Yet, if eye catching color is not for you, no matter how subtle it may be, try a pop of soft color with a basic; like a light pink cardigan over khaki trouser pants, it’s completely effective in keeping with the season, even if it is still chilly outside!

Layering is another go to style for achieving this look; oversize cardigans over tee shirts, tights and skirts, etc etc. However, when going with such a decidedly natural color scheme, it is always fun to do something a little extra; which is where accessorizing is not only handy, but imperative!
